兔子--android.view.windowmanager BadTokenException :unable to add window token null is not for applica
2015-07-13 11:00
393 查看
导致报这个错是在于new AlertDialog.Builder(mcontext),虽然这里的参数是AlertDialog.Builder(Context context)但我们不能使用getApplicationContext()获得的Context,而必须使用Activity,因为只有一个Activity才能添加一个窗体。
环境变量传入错误,不能使application的环境,应该是Activity的环境
new AlertDialog.Builder(MyActivity.this)
.setIcon(android.R.drawable.ic_launch)
.setTitle("Warnning")
.setMessage("haha")
.setPositiveButton("Yes", positiveListener).setNegativeButton(
"No", negativeListener).create().show();
环境变量传入错误,不能使application的环境,应该是Activity的环境
new AlertDialog.Builder(MyActivity.this)
.setIcon(android.R.drawable.ic_launch)
.setTitle("Warnning")
.setMessage("haha")
.setPositiveButton("Yes", positiveListener).setNegativeButton(
"No", negativeListener).create().show();
相关文章推荐
- 【unity】编辑器基本扩展(一)
- 自动生成地图 物体 Generator
- 极光推送 与 原生推送的概念小结
- Android编译篇
- Android高仿微信微博多图展示
- Android中查看安装程序的信息
- iOS开发UI篇 -- UIWebView
- iOS 代码tableViewCell自适应label
- Android按钮单击事件的四种常用写法总结
- iOS推送小结(证书的生成、客户端的开发、服务端的开发)
- Android 异步和超时处理 例子
- @MappedSuperclass
- (ros/navigation/gmapping)导航/建地图
- 正式开始android学习
- Android 调用已安装市场,进行软件评分的功能实现
- EventBus在Android中的简单使用
- Android_按比例布局layout_weight和weightSum
- Android孔式打开的Splash效果
- Android URI和URL和URN的区别
- Android 自定义适配器